Explore the nearby town of Garstang, where you will find a delightful selection of independent shops, including a cheesemonger which sells the popular Lancashire cheese, as well as pubs, restaurants and tea rooms, and the weekly local market which takes place on Thursdays. Booths, our local supermarket just 2 minutes away which Sells fine foods and local produce as well as having a lovely café. Embrace local life with a walk along the picturesque Lancaster Canal where you can even spot the local wildlife or simply just watch the world go by. A very popular walk is Nicky Nook, located in Scorton, a very pretty village well worth a visit less than a 10-minute drive from here. Nicky Nook is hilly and has quite a steep incline, once you have tackled the steep start the rest is beautiful and the view on a clear day makes it all worthwhile, especially having a lovely cafe at the foot of the hill which serves lovely food, coffee and home made cakes. Take advantage of the close proximity to the scenic Forest of Bowland, where you will find a selection of charming villages, the Bowland Wild Boar Park, and the impressive 16th-century Browsholme Hall and Tith Barn, grand home with expansive gardens ready to be explored. If you fancy some family fun The Flower Bowl entertainment centre is just a two-minute drive from here and offers a small, intimate, cinema with luxury velvet seats and small audiences, curling, bowling, crazy golf and other games such as a golf simulator. There is a fish a chip restaurant here too, a coffee bar and Blooms restaurant to enjoy. Take a trip to Lancaster, well-known for it’s remarkable 12th-century castle which houses a prison and a museum, as well as informative talks. Delve into the town’s history at the Lancaster Museum which is settled in the magnificent former 18th-century town hall or pay a visit to the archaeological site of the Roman Baths. All-ground-floor. Two bedrooms: 1 x king size double with en-suite walk-in shower, basin, heated towel rail and WC, 1 x twin with TV. Bathroom with bath, basin, heated towel rail and WC. Open-plan living space with kitchen, dining area and sitting area with electric fire I

Facilities

Gas central heating with electric fire. Electric oven and induction hob, microwave, fridge, freezer, dishwasher. TV with Sky, WiFi.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Hot tub towels also provided. Highchair, travel cot and stairgate available. Off-road parking. Large patio with furniture and hot tub. Sorry no pets and no smoking. Shop 1.2 miles, pub 1.1 miles,
